Great wines reflect the qualities of the land, the climate, and the people that bring them into being. We know that the unique nature of the Okanagan will soon yield wines as identifiable as those from Bordeaux, Burgundy, or Napa—distinctly Okanagan wines, rich in flavour and character.

At Painted Rock, we intend to be at the forefront of this development, producing superb wines, carefully crafted from our estate-grown grapes. The particular microclimate of our vineyard, combined with the meticulous attention of our vineyard team to crop load, water, nutrients, and canopy, are already producing outstanding grapes on healthy vines, and promise to do so year after year.

From these grapes will come the wines we expect to be emblematic of the emerging Okanagan region. Our winemaker, Gavin Miller, in consultation with Alain Sutre, of Etrus Consultants (Bordeaux), is offered every possible advantage: regular meetings with the vineyard team, a superior knowledge of the terroir, and state of the art winemaking equipment. Together, we look forward to achieving our collective goal of truly great, world class Okanagan wines!
